Bushwick Rent Report — December 2022

Asking rents in ZIP 11237, New York City, from 166 listings.

Median 1BR rent in Bushwick was $2,899 in December 2022, up 11.5% (+$299) from November 2022 and down 14.7% year-over-year. The middle half of 1BR listings asked between $2,735 and $2,995. That puts Bushwick $678 above the New York City citywide 1BR median of $2,222. The month's figures are based on 166 listings across 12 bedroom categories.
